I did like what I played, the atmosphere and presentation are well done in my opinion (in an Outlast-ish way), and the engine is a decent one. With everything maxed out though, the game requires >4GB of video memory, and in order to avoid stutters, with the 970 I had to settle for a mix between V-High and High at 1080p/60fps/TAA with magic sharpen through Reshade.
The problem is, this demo doesn't tell us much really. It's practically...a single setpiece, or perhaps, the whole game is? xD We shall find it in mid 2017 when we'll get the Yarr Edition, I guess.
